There are limitations associated with retrospective chart audits.
These include incomplete documentation, missing charts and
difficulty interpreting information found in the documents.
However, because this chart review had only 6% of the sample
missing, it can be argued that the missing data did not bias the
findings. Furthermore,the data analysis was undertaken on the
data retrieved from the 423 pain charts located.
The review did not include report of the specific surgical
procedure the patient had undergone—this was not the
purpose of the study. Furthermore, it is likely that capturing
specific surgical procedure would not have allowed for
statistical comparisons owing to the size of the cohort
(small).The purpose of this review was to gain insight into
nurse assessment of neuropathic pain. Further research with
larger numbers in specific surgery is warranted to enable
understanding of the impact of surgery type and development
of signs of neuropathic pain.
